Comcast bids for Disney
11th February 2004 by Simon
20 minutes ago, Comcast made it public that they intend to bid for Disney. CNN has a copy of the letter from the Comcast CEO, Brian L. Roberts, writing to Disney CEO, Michael D. Eisner.
The deal is estimated as being worth around US$66Bn, making Comcast the largest the media company in the world.
